Dilaton-driven confinement
Abstract
We derive a solution of type IIB supergravity which is asymptotic to AdS_5 x S^5, has SO(6) symmetry, and exhibits some of the features expected of geometries dual to confining gauge theories. At the linearized level, the solution differs from pure AdS_5 x S^5 only by a dilaton profile. It has a naked singularity in the interior. Wilson loops follow area law behavior, and there is a mass gap. We suggest a field theory interpretation in which all matter fields of N=4 gauge theory acquire a mass and the infrared theory is confining.
